Exploring The Various Types Of Leadership Development

Leadership development is essential for the growth and success of any organization. It is a process that aims to enhance the abilities and skills of individuals in leadership positions. There are various types of leadership development programs that organizations can implement to cultivate effective leaders. Each type focuses on different aspects of leadership and helps individuals improve their leadership capabilities. Let’s explore some of the most common types of leadership development:

1. Coaching and Mentoring Programs
Coaching and mentoring programs are designed to provide one-on-one guidance and support to individuals in leadership roles. In these programs, experienced leaders or external coaches work closely with the participants to help them identify their strengths and weaknesses, set goals, and develop strategies for improvement. Coaching and mentoring programs can help leaders improve their communication skills, decision-making abilities, and emotional intelligence.

2. Leadership Training Workshops
Leadership training workshops are intensive, interactive sessions that focus on specific leadership skills and competencies. These workshops are typically conducted in a classroom setting and cover topics such as effective communication, team building, conflict resolution, and strategic planning. Participants engage in activities, role-playing exercises, and discussions to enhance their understanding of key leadership concepts and practice applying them in real-world scenarios.

3. Executive Education Programs
Executive education programs are advanced leadership development programs designed for high-level executives and senior managers. These programs are often offered by prestigious business schools and universities and cover a wide range of topics, including organizational strategy, financial management, and global leadership. Executive education programs are designed to broaden participants’ perspectives, enhance their strategic thinking abilities, and equip them with the tools they need to lead their organizations to success.

4. On-the-Job Training
On-the-job training is a hands-on approach to leadership development that allows individuals to learn and grow in their roles while performing their day-to-day duties. This type of leadership development involves shadowing experienced leaders, working on special projects, and receiving feedback from supervisors. On-the-job training helps leaders develop practical skills, build confidence, and gain valuable experience that can be applied directly to their roles.

5. Leadership Assessments
Leadership assessments are tools used to evaluate individuals’ leadership strengths and areas for improvement. These assessments typically involve self-assessment surveys, 360-degree feedback from peers and subordinates, and psychometric tests. By identifying their leadership styles, behaviors, and competencies, individuals can gain valuable insights into how they can improve their leadership effectiveness and performance.

6. Team Building Activities
Team building activities are a fun and engaging way to develop leadership skills and strengthen team dynamics. These activities involve collaborative exercises, problem-solving challenges, and trust-building exercises that encourage communication, cooperation, and teamwork. Team building activities help leaders develop essential skills such as conflict resolution, decision-making, and adaptability, while also fostering a positive and supportive team culture.

7. Leadership Retreats
Leadership retreats are immersive experiences that allow leaders to step away from their daily responsibilities and focus on personal and professional growth. These retreats typically involve workshops, seminars, outdoor activities, and networking opportunities. Leadership retreats provide leaders with a chance to reflect on their leadership style, set goals for the future, and connect with other leaders facing similar challenges.
